Book Early for Peak Season
Tours fill quickly during summer months; secure your spot by booking in advance to avoid disappointment.
Bring Swimwear and Towel
Most boat tours include stops for swimming; come prepared to dive into the clear waters.
Choose Suitable Footwear
Wear non-slip shoes or sandals for safe boarding and walking on boat decks and rocky shores.
Pack Sunscreen and Hydration
The Adriatic sun can be intense; bring water and protective sunscreen to stay comfortable and safe.

Setting off on a boat tour near Split promises a direct encounter with the Adriatic’s rugged coastline and crystalline waters. This vibrant city serves as the perfect gateway to explore hidden coves, historic islands, and secluded beaches that stand ready to be discovered. Whether you crave an adrenaline rush or a tranquil escape, the options range from speedboat rides skimming the sea’s surface to relaxed sailing trips cutting through calm bays.
A boat tour near Split brings the city’s maritime heritage alive, offering practical access to extraordinary natural features. Views of steep limestone cliffs pushing skyward meet the inviting blue-green waters below, which seem to call travelers forward with an irresistible pull. Popular destinations include the nearby islands of Brač and Šolta, each offering unique landscapes and clear waters ideal for swimming and snorkeling.
When planning your boat trip, consider departure points around Split’s waterfront, where operators provide well-maintained vessels equipped for safety and comfort. Tours generally range from half-day excursions to full-day explorations, and many include stops at local taverns or swimming spots, so pack your swimwear and sun protection. Booking in advance is advised, especially during peak months, to secure the best spots and tour options.

Frequently Asked Questions
What islands can I visit on a boat tour from Split?
Popular islands include Brač, Šolta, and Hvar, each offering pristine beaches, quaint villages, and opportunities for swimming or snorkeling. Some tours also include lesser-known islets favored for their tranquility.
Do boat tours provide equipment for swimming and snorkeling?
Many tours supply snorkeling gear and flotation devices, but it’s best to check with your operator ahead of time. Bringing your own equipment can ensure the best fit and comfort.
Are boat tours suitable for families with children?
Yes, most operators accommodate families, providing safety measures and shorter itineraries to suit younger guests. Confirm age restrictions and safety provisions with your tour provider beforehand.
What wildlife might I see during a boat tour?
Keep an eye out for dolphins often spotted offshore, various seabirds like cormorants, and colorful marine life visible near the surface during snorkeling stops.
How can I avoid crowds when taking a boat tour?
Choose early morning departures or shoulder-season months when fewer tourists visit. Private or small-group tours also help in avoiding busy locations.
What local cultural spots are accessible by boat?
Besides natural attractions, some boat routes lead to small seaside villages offering fresh seafood taverns, ancient chapels, and traditional fishing culture insights.
